The Ultimate Guide: What Is the Ratio of Cooked Rice to Raw Rice?

5 min read
When cooked, one cup of raw rice can expand to produce nearly three cups of cooked rice, primarily because the grains absorb a significant amount of water during the cooking process. This substantial volume increase is crucial for accurate meal planning and portion control, whether you're feeding a large family or tracking your caloric intake. Understanding the precise conversion ratio prevents waste and ensures perfectly cooked rice every time.
